My RS has stopped working with the error
aspnet_wp!library!234!09/20/2004-12:40:41:: e ERROR: Throwing
Microsoft.ReportingServices.Diagnostics.Utilities.InternalCatalogException:
An internal error occurred on the report server. See the error log for more
details., ;
Info:
Microsoft.ReportingServices.Diagnostics.Utilities.InternalCatalogException:
An internal error occurred on the report server. See the error log for more
details. --> System.Runtime.InteropServices.COMException (0x8009000B):
Key not valid for use in specified state.
The only thing that has changed recently was the dotnet framework 1.1 SP1
update. Is this the cause, or is there some other issue?
brian smithOK, I think this is to do with originally installing the 120 day trial
version. When I got the full version on CD I ran the update and assumed that
fixed everything. How do I resolve this - must I uninstall and re-install?
